WebHughes syndrome is thickening of the circulating blood caused by an abnormal immune system. Complications include heart attack, stroke and recurrent miscarriage. Thickening is often accompanied by increased formation of blood clots, which can clog blood vessels, preventing normal blood flow. If a blood clot clogs a vessel in the heart or brain, a heart attack or stroke may occur, possibly with a fatal outcome.

WebThe main cause of haemorrhagic stroke is high blood pressure, which can weaken the arteries in the brain and make them more likely to split or rupture. Things that increase the risk of high blood pressure include: being overweight drinking excessive amounts of alcohol smoking a lack of exercise stress
